Common Gate Problems That Require Repair
Gates, whether manual or automatic, can face various issues that require professional repair. Here are some common problems:
1. Gate Not Opening or Closing
One of the most common issues with automatic gates is the failure to open or close. This could be caused by:
-
Damaged motors
-
Faulty wiring
-
Blockages in the tracks
A professional gate repair technician can diagnose and fix the underlying cause to restore proper functionality.
2. Broken Gate Springs
Gate springs, especially on swing gates, can wear out or break over time. A broken spring can cause the gate to become unbalanced, making it difficult or impossible to open. Replacing the spring requires professional expertise to ensure proper alignment.
3. Misaligned Gate Tracks
For sliding gates, misalignment of the tracks can prevent smooth operation. Misalignment can occur due to wear and tear or external factors like weather or accidents. A gate repair expert can realign the tracks and ensure the gate operates smoothly again.
4. Rust or Corrosion
Gates exposed to the elements, particularly metal gates, can develop rust or corrosion. This not only affects the gate’s appearance but also its structural integrity. A professional repair company can sand down the rust, apply protective coatings, and restore the gate’s appearance.
5. Faulty Gate Sensors
Automatic gates have sensors that detect objects in their path to prevent accidents. If these sensors malfunction, the gate might not function correctly. A gate repair technician can test and replace faulty sensors to ensure safety and proper operation.

How to Choose the Best Gate Repair Company Near You
When choosing a gate repair company, consider the following factors to ensure you get the best service:
1. Experience and Reputation
Look for a company with a solid track record of successful repairs. Check customer reviews and testimonials to gauge the quality of their work.
2. Licensing and Insurance
Make sure the gate repair company is licensed and insured. This protects you in case of accidents or damage during the repair process.
3. Prompt and Reliable Service
Choose a company known for its quick response times and punctuality. Gates that aren’t working can pose security risks, so you want a company that can act fast.
4. Affordability
Get quotes from multiple companies to compare prices. While you shouldn’t compromise on quality, ensure that you’re getting fair pricing for the services offered.
